End-to-end architecture, runtime boundaries, and request flow

System Architecture and Application Composition

Overview

TeamHub is composed as a split Angular client and ASP.NET Core Web API backend. The browser-side application starts from , boots AppModule, and routes users into login and registration screens. The backend starts from , loads configuration from environment sources, registers application services, then builds the middleware pipeline that protects and executes both minimal API project routes and controller-based authentication routes.

The runtime boundary is layered around three main concerns: presentation in Angular, HTTP/API orchestration in ASP.NET Core, and persistence plus caching through EF Core and Redis. Project workflows are implemented as MediatR CQRS handlers behind minimal API endpoints, while authentication is handled through AuthenticationController with JWT access tokens and refresh-token persistence. Docker assets define the production shape of the system as three cooperating containers: API, SQL Server, and Redis.

Backend Host and Middleware Pipeline

TeamcollborationHub.server/Program.cs

This is the backend host entry point. It loads environment values, builds the application configuration, registers services, builds the app, attaches middleware, and starts the web host.

Step What happens
DotEnv.Load() Loads .env values before host creation
WebApplication.CreateBuilder(args) Creates the ASP.NET Core host builder
AddEnvironmentVariables Reads environment variables with the .env prefix
AddUserSecrets<Program>() Loads user secrets for local development
RegisterServices(configuration) Registers application, persistence, auth, cache, and infrastructure services
Build() Produces the final WebApplication instance
RegisterMiddlewares() Maps endpoints and attaches the request pipeline
Run() Starts the host

TeamcollborationHub.server/Middlewares/RegisterMiddlewares.cs

This extension method defines the request pipeline order. It maps the minimal API endpoints first, then enables Swagger for development, exception handling, test IP normalization, Redis-backed rate limiting, HTTPS redirection, authentication, authorization, and finally controller routing.

Order Middleware or action Purpose
1 app.MapEndpoints() Registers minimal API project endpoints
2 app.UseSwagger() / app.UseSwaggerUI() Exposes API docs in development
3 app.UseExceptionHandler() Routes unhandled exceptions through the configured exception handler
4 testing IP override middleware Forces RemoteIpAddress to 127.0.0.1 in the testing environment
5 app.UseMiddleware<IpBasedRateLimiter>() Applies IP-based request throttling
6 app.UseHttpsRedirection() Redirects requests to HTTPS
7 app.UseAuthentication() Validates JWT authentication
8 app.UseAuthorization() Enforces authorization metadata
9 app.MapControllers() Activates controller routes such as /login, /signup, and /refresh

TeamcollborationHub.server/Middlewares/IpBasedRateLimiter.cs

This middleware uses Redis and a Lua script to enforce IP-based throttling before the request reaches authentication, authorization, controllers, or minimal APIs. It reads the maxReq configuration value and applies a fixed 60-second expiry window.

Property or field Type Description
_logger ILogger<IpBasedRateLimiter> Logs rate-limiting warnings
_luaScript LuaScript Atomic Redis request-count script
_redisDatabase IDatabase Redis database used for counter storage
_next RequestDelegate Next middleware in the pipeline
_maxRequests int Maximum requests allowed in the expiry window
_configuration IConfiguration Source for the maxReq setting
Expiry int Fixed expiration window of 60 seconds
Method Description
InvokeAsync Reads the client IP, increments the Redis counter, returns 429 when the threshold is exceeded, otherwise delegates to the next middleware

Redis-backed request counting

The middleware uses the client IP string as the Redis key and executes the registered Lua script atomically. When the script returns 1, the middleware short-circuits the request with 429 Too Many Requests; otherwise it invokes _next(context).

Authentication Boundary

TeamcollborationHub.server/Controllers/AuthenticationController.cs

AuthenticationController exposes the login, signup, and refresh endpoints. It orchestrates IAuthenticationService and ITokenService to validate users, issue JWT access tokens, create refresh tokens, and persist the refresh token record.

Dependency Type Description
authenticationService IAuthenticationService Validates users and creates new accounts
tokenService ITokenService Generates JWTs, refresh tokens, and persists refresh-token state
Property or field Type Description
_authenticationService IAuthenticationService Stored authentication service dependency used by Login and SignUp
Method Description
Login Validates credentials, generates an access token, creates a refresh token, saves it, and returns LoginResponseDto
SignUp Creates a user account and returns RegisterUserDto
Refresh Validates the supplied refresh token, rotates it, and returns a new access token and refresh token

Authentication workflow

  • Login rejects a null body with BadRequest("Invalid user data").
  • Login returns NotFound("Invalid user data") when credential validation fails.
  • On success, it creates a RefreshToken, saves it through tokenService.SaveRefreshToken, and returns Ok(...).
  • SignUp follows the same null-body guard and returns BadRequest("Invalid user data") if account creation fails.
  • Refresh rejects missing refresh tokens with BadRequest("no refresh token found") and invalid tokens with NotFound("Invalid refresh token").

Project Workflow Boundary

TeamcollborationHub.server/Endpoints/ProjectEndpoints.cs

ProjectEndpoints maps the minimal API surface for project workflows. Every route in this file is protected with RequireAuthorization(), and the cache is consulted before several read operations. Write operations call MediatR commands and then write the returned Project back to the cache using result.Id.ToString().

Dependency Type Description
mediator IMediator Executes CQRS queries and commands
cachingService ICachingService<Project, string> Reads and writes cached project aggregates
Method Description
MapEndpoints Registers all project HTTP endpoints onto WebApplication

Project cache flow

  • GET /api/projects/{id:int} reads id.ToString() from cache before sending GetProjectByIdQuery.
  • GET /api/projects/{id:int}/contributors, /tasks, and /comments read the cached Project aggregate first and only hit MediatR when the cache does not have the aggregate.
  • POST, PUT, and DELETE routes call a command handler and then call SetProjectInCache(result.Id.ToString(), result) with the returned aggregate.
  • The cache key format is consistently the project identifier converted to a string.

Persistence Boundary

TeamcollborationHub.server/Configuration/TdbContext.cs

TdbContext is the EF Core persistence boundary for the application. It exposes the project, task, comment, user, and refresh-token sets, and its constructor proactively creates the database and tables when the relational database exists but is not initialized.

Property Type Description
Users DbSet<User> User table
Projects DbSet<Project> Project table
Tasks DbSet<ProjectTask> Task table
Comments DbSet<Comment> Comment table
RefreshTokens DbSet<RefreshToken> Refresh token table
Constructor dependency Type Description
options DbContextOptions<TdbContext> EF Core options used to connect to SQL Server
Method Description
OnModelCreating Configures relationships, unique email indexing, and enum conversion for Project.Status

Model composition

  • Project has many Contributors, Tasks, and Comments.
  • User is linked to a project through ProjectId.
  • RefreshToken belongs to a User.
  • User.Email is configured with a unique index.
  • Project.Status is stored as a string in the database through value conversion.

TeamcollborationHub.server/docker-compose.yml

This file defines the runtime topology used by the API in containers.

Service Image Ports Volumes Environment
db mcr.microsoft.com/mssql/server:2022-latest 1433:1433 sqlserver_data:/var/lib/mssql/data ACCEPT_EULA=sa, MSSQL_SA_PASSWORD=Password1
api ahtat204/teamhub 8080:8080 ./certs/KestrelSSLCertficate.pfx:/app/KestrelSSLCertficate.pfx:ro ASPNETCORE_ENVIRONMENT, DB_HOST, DB_NAME, CLIENT_ID, CLIENT_SECRET, ISSUER, AUDIENCE, DURATIONINMINUTES, sqlserverconnectionstring, RedisConnectionString, KEY
cache redis:6.2-alpine none declared redis-data:/data none declared

The API container depends on both db and cache, which makes the container topology explicit: SQL Server stores application data, Redis backs cache and throttling, and the API container binds them together.

TeamCollaborationHub.server.IntegrationTest/TestDependencies/TeamHubApplicationFactory.cs

This WebApplicationFactory-based test host reproduces the server boundary with Testcontainers. It starts a disposable SQL Server container and a Redis container, replaces the production TdbContext registration, and wires Redis-based services to the test containers.

Property Type Description
SqlServerContainer MsSqlContainer SQL Server Testcontainers instance
_redisContainer RedisContainer Redis Testcontainers instance
Method Description
ConfigureWebHost Replaces production test services with container-backed SQL Server and Redis registrations
InitializeAsync Starts both containers
DisposeAsync Stops both containers

Test runtime flow

  • The host uses UseEnvironment("Testing").
  • IDatabase is resolved from the Testcontainers Redis connection string.
  • AddStackExchangeRedisCache is redirected to the Redis container.
  • TdbContext is re-registered against the container SQL Server connection string.
  • The SQL Server container is initialized with InitialCatalog = "master" and TrustServerCertificate = true.

Testing Considerations

  • TeamcollaborationHub.server.UnitTest uses NUnit and in-memory EF Core to exercise the project handlers and AuthenticationController.
  • TeamCollaborationHub.server.IntegrationTest uses xUnit plus Testcontainers for SQL Server and Redis.
  • Program is exposed as a partial class so WebApplicationFactory<Program> can host the API in integration tests.
  • The testing environment path in RegisterMiddlewares forces a loopback IP address, which makes the rate limiter deterministic in tests.
  • AuthenticationControllerTest covers success and failure paths for login and signup.
  • Project handler tests cover create, read, add contributor, add task, add comment, remove contributor, remove task, and deadline validation flows.
